What a Correct Siding Installation Actually Involves
The siding itself is only part of the system. Most siding failures we get called out to inspect in this part of the county aren't failures of the siding material — they're failures of what's underneath it or how it was fastened. A correct installation includes:
- A continuous weather-resistive barrier installed over the sheathing, lapped correctly so water always drains outward and downward
- Properly integrated flashing at every window, door, and roof-to-wall transition — the single most common place we find water intrusion on older homes
- Correct fastener type, spacing, and depth per James Hardie's published installation specifications, not generic siding nailing patterns
- Minimum clearance between the bottom edge of the siding and grade, decks, patios, and roof lines, so splashback and standing water can't wick into the material
- Caulked and sealed joints at trim and penetrations, using products rated for the specific application
Skip any one of these steps and you can end up with siding that looks fine from the curb while moisture is already working its way into the wall assembly behind it. James Hardie's warranty coverage assumes the product was installed to spec — a rushed or improvised install can put that coverage at risk even when the boards themselves are flawless.
Where Sumas Homes Are Most Exposed
North- and east-facing walls that stay shaded most of the day are where we see the earliest signs of moss and algae growth on siding in this area. Lower wall sections near grade, planters, or sprinkler zones take on more standing moisture than upper stories. And any wall that catches driving rain head-on during winter storms needs flashing and caulking details done right the first time, because re-doing them later means removing siding that's already been installed.

Signs Your Sumas Home May Need New Siding
Siding damage isn't always obvious from the street. Some of the most common warning signs we find during inspections include:
- Soft or spongy spots when you press on the siding, especially near the bottom courses
- Persistent moss, algae, or dark streaking that comes back within weeks of cleaning
- Visible warping, buckling, or gaps between siding panels
- Peeling or bubbling paint, which often signals moisture trapped behind the finish
- Rising energy bills without another clear explanation, which can point to compromised wall insulation and air sealing behind failing siding
- Rot or discoloration around window and door trim
Any one of these on its own isn't necessarily an emergency, but catching them early is a lot cheaper than waiting until the sheathing or framing underneath is compromised.
Comparing Siding Options for a Sumas Climate
| Material | Moisture Resistance | Maintenance Burden | Typical Finish Life |
|---|---|---|---|
| James Hardie fiber cement | Excellent — engineered for moisture-heavy climates | Low — factory ColorPlus finish, occasional washing | 15+ years before repaint consideration |
| Vinyl siding | Fair — can trap moisture at gaps and seams | Low, but prone to warping and fading over time | Fades with UV exposure; not repaintable in practice |
| LP SmartSide / wood composite | Good if finish is intact; poor once compromised | Moderate to high — strict repaint schedule required | 5–8 years before repaint typically needed |
| Cedar | Fair — natural material, absorbs and releases moisture | High — regular sealing and refinishing required | 3–5 years before refinishing typically needed |

What Drives the Cost of a Siding Installation
| Factor | Why It Matters |
|---|---|
| Home size and wall complexity | More square footage and more corners, gables, and dormers mean more material and labor time |
| Sheathing condition | Rot or water damage found during tear-off adds repair work before new siding can go on |
| Siding profile chosen | Lap siding, shingle-style panels, and board-and-batten each have different material and labor costs |
| Trim and detail work | Window casings, corner boards, and fascia detailing add labor beyond the flat wall area |
| Accessibility | Steep rooflines, tight lot lines, or multi-story walls affect staging and labor time |
